Senior Embedded Software Engineer
***HIRING ACROSS MULTIPLE LOCATIONS: PROVIDENCE, RI; RALEIGH, NC; ORANGE, CA; MINNEAPOLIS, MN
About This Role:
Veranex has an exciting opportunity to join our team as a Senior Embedded Software Engineer. You will be part of a team working to improve lives globally through medical technology innovation.
What You Will Do:
• Execute full software development life cycle including requirements capture, architecture, implementation, testing within the medtech industry.
• Collaborate with other design disciplines including systems, electrical, and mechanical engineering
• Support the software development team with translating high level software requirements into detailed software requirements, supporting the documented software architecture
• Verify that the documented architecture is implemented according to plan through participation in code reviews and design reviews throughout the process
• Embedded Linux user space application development and sustenance
• User Interface application development and sustenance
Qualifications
- 4+ years of experience in embedded software development within the medtech industry (or other equivalent safety critical software development experience).
- 4+ years of experience in C++ application development in embedded space
- Knowledgeable of operating systems, multithreading, memory management, debugging using GDB
- Knowledgeable of embedded software development
- Knowledgeable of microprocessor/microcontroller bring-up and embedded device drivers
- Demonstrated software programming proficiency (C, C++, and scripting languages such as Python)
- Understanding of electronic circuitry including board bring up ad on target debugging.
- Understanding of interfacing with on and off chip peripherals such as USB, SPI, UART I2C, ADC's and DAC's
- Experience with user space application development in embedded Linux
- Understanding of processor and hardware requirements in embedded Linux
- Knowledgeable of open system interconnection (OSI) model and its application to network design
- Knowledge of UI frameworks such as Qt/QML or any other UI software
- Experience in working in a Continuous Integration (CI) environment
- Experience with Software Configuration Management
- Proven track record of successfully leading technically complex development projects and transitions to production
- Knowledge in Agile/Scrum-based product development
- Strong verbal and written communications skills and the ability to communicate effectively across all levels of the organization
- Ability to excel in a fast-paced and dynamic work environment
- Bachelor's degree in computer engineering (or equivalent)
Preferred:
- Experience with software development for medical devices and associated standards (IEC 62304)
- Experience with software quality systems
- Experience using Atlassian Tools of equivalent for software development
- Experience deploying commercial embedded Linux systems
- Proficiency with open-source cross-compiler tools and Linux kernel development
- Experience with unit testing including test case development with unit test frameworks such as GoogleTest
- Experience with Laboratory Information Systems (LIS)
- Excellent knowledge of cloud computing technologies and current computing trends.
- Knowledge of real-time operating systems, microcontrollers, and RTOS
- Master's degree in computer or electrical engineering (or equivalent)
